Understanding Sales Recruiting Job Boards

What Are Sales Recruiting Job Boards?

Sales recruiting job boards are specialized online platforms designed to connect employers seeking to fill sales positions with candidates looking for opportunities in the sales field. Unlike generic job boards, these platforms are tailored to the unique needs of sales roles, allowing recruiters to post job listings that specifically target skilled sales professionals. This focused approach enhances the likelihood of attracting suitable candidates who possess the necessary sales skills and experience.

Comparing Pricing Models and ROI

Understanding the pricing structure of various sales recruiting job boards is also vital. Some platforms operate on a pay-per-post model, while others may offer subscription plans or performance-based pricing. By comparing these models, organizations can assess the potential return on investment (ROI) for each board.

It’s essential to evaluate not just the immediate costs but also the value offered by each platform. Consider metrics such as the average time taken to fill a position, the quality of candidates sourced, and the overall satisfaction of hiring managers with the outcomes yielded from each board. These factors are essential for determining which job boards will yield the best results for your sales recruitment efforts.

Measuring the Effectiveness of Your Job Board Listings

Key Performance Indicators for Recruitment Ads

To gauge the effectiveness of job board listings, it’s important to track relevant key performance indicators (KPIs). Metrics such as the number of applications received, the quality of candidates (measured by the number of interviews and hires), and the time taken to fill a position are all important data points. Evaluating these indicators can help organizations assess the effectiveness of each job board and adapt their future recruitment strategies.

Furthermore, consider measuring candidate engagement levels, such as click-through rates and time spent on the job posting, to gain deeper insights into how potential employees interact with the listing.
